Giro wrap: redemption for Roglič; what next for Ineos?; Lefevere says ”hands off Remco”; Britain’s young talent face funding crisis

Roglič redemption: Thomas the fall guy as Primož slays his demons. We hear from Jumbo-Visma's Grand Tour debutant and reluctant oboeist Thomas Gloag about his Giro and riding for the race's newly-crowned champion.

Plus, Olympic champion Ed Clancy, a close friend of Mark Cavendish's since they were kids, reflects on the Briton's stunning final stage victory in Rome.

Ineos left shattered as Jumbo numbers tell in the end. Sports director Oli Cookson gives the British team's perspective on the second Giro in succession where victory has been snatched from them on the final mountain stage.

Tug of love: Patrick Lefevere tells Ineos "hands off Remco!" How will the behind-the-scenes battle for the prodigiously talented world champion play out?

News exclusive: We reveal that the conveyor belt of young road racing talent that's been produced over the last two decades by British Cycling under-23 racing programmes could end as funding looks set to be cut completely – unless the federation's members take a stand.
